Barcelona Explains the Reason for Not Renewing Messi's Contract

Lionel Messi, widely regarded as one of the greatest footballers of all time, will not be renewing his contract with Barcelona. This news has sent shockwaves throughout the footballing world, as Messi has been an integral part of Barcelona's success for over two decades. In this article, we will explore the reasons behind Barcelona's decision.

Financial Constraints:

One of the primary reasons for Barcelona's inability to renew Messi's contract is the financial constraints faced by the club. Barcelona has been grappling with severe financial difficulties in recent years, exacerbated by the impact of the COVID-19 pandemic. The club's wage bill and transfer expenses have reached unsustainable levels, forcing them to make some tough decisions. As a result, they were unable to meet the salary demands of their star player.

La Liga Regulations:

In addition to financial constraints, Barcelona's decision was also influenced by the regulations set forth by La Liga, the top professional football league in Spain. La Liga operates under a strict financial fair play system, which aims to ensure clubs do not accumulate excessive debt. Barcelona's significant debt burden made it difficult for them to comply with these regulations while keeping Messi at the club.
